GNV gives assurance over service levels

GENOA-based ferry company Grandi Navi Veloci has responded to criticism on service levels from port officials and local politicians in northern Sardinia, reaffirming its commitment to the Genoa-Porto Torres route.
In a statement, the company said it would continue to work the service through the winter months with three calls a week in Porto Torres...
